Iran joins Venezuela, Libya to say no harm in $100 oil

Sunday, January 16th 2011
Iran joins Venezuela, Libya to say no harm in $100 oil

OPEC’s leading oil price hawk Iran joined Venezuela and Libya on Sunday to say it saw no need for the cartel to consider raising crude supplies to rein in crude prices now near $100 a barrel. Spill panel calls for offshore drilling reform

Tuesday, January 11th 2011
Spill panel calls for offshore drilling reform

Blaming the massive BP oil spill on government and industry complacency, a White House panel on Tuesday called for a dramatic overhaul of the way the U.S. regulates offshore drilling.
